Cape Vincent Village Police Department:
The Cape Vincent Police Department is currently in possession of a bucket of workman’s tools that were located along the side of State Route 12E near the Stone Quarry Road in the town of Cape Vincent sometime around June 20, 2018. The tools were turned over to police while investigating an unrelated incident.
Anyone that believes these tools may belong to them are encourage to contact police at (315) 654-3400 and leave a message referencing case number #18CV00075. You will be contacted and asked to provide a full description of the tools to verify ownership.
